The Colorado Daily Snow

By Meteorologist Joel Gratz
Thursday May 23rd at 10:47am MDT
Low clouds did in fact cover the plains and foothills this morning, with mountains above 10,000 feet poking out into the sunshine. Here is a satellite image of the clouds over eastern Colorado, and you can see them dissipating as the air gradually warms. And here is a great view looking east from the Pikes Peak webcam, sitting at 14,110ft and well over the clouds. This afternoon should become sunnier with a small chance for a storm over the foothills...
